Имя: Пароль:
1C
1С v8
Присвоить значение реквизиту .Что делаю не так?
0 AlexBor
 
naïve
03.10.14
15:59
В документе создал реквизит в который записывается Итого по колонки из табличной части. Далее в обработке:

Выборка = Документы.Предписание.Выбрать();
Пока Выборка.Следующий() Цикл
Документ = Выборка.ПолучитьОбъект();
n=Выборка.ТаблицаНарушений.Итог("Количество");
Документ.Записать();    
Сообщить(Документ);
КонецЦикла;

Запускаю обработку и потом проверяю отчетом -- и пусто. Что сделал не так?
1 Defender aka LINN
 
03.10.14
16:01
А что этот код вообще символизирует? Ну, кроме уныния и отчаяния.
2 Килограмм
 
03.10.14
16:02
Что за n ?
3 Enders
 
03.10.14
16:02
а где заполнение реквизита?
4 AlexBor
 
naïve
03.10.14
16:04
n -  реквизит в в документе предписание n=Выборка.ТаблицаНарушений.Итог("Количество"); которы собирает Итог из ТЧ - таблица нарушений;
5 silent person
 
03.10.14
16:04
Документ.n - вот это реквизит в документе, а у тебя просто "n"
6 Ёпрст
 
03.10.14
16:05
(0) Вон из профессии!
7 AlexBor
 
naïve
03.10.14
16:06
(6) нет нет не выгоняйте я болше ничего делать не умею
8 Ёпрст
 
03.10.14
16:07
(7) Ну, подметать же улицы могёшь ?.. мети!
9 AlexBor
 
naïve
03.10.14
16:07
(5) Спасибо теперь ясно у меня все получилось
10 Banned
 
03.10.14
16:07
(8) А я бы не доверил такому...
11 AlexBor
 
naïve
03.10.14
16:07
(8) Откуда такая увереность .... ничего кроме 1с немогу делать
12 butterbean
 
03.10.14
16:07
(7) не льсти себе
13 Михаил Козлов
 
03.10.14
16:08
(0) Сделайте как в типовых: в ПередЗаписью (объекта) заполняйте Ваш реквизит.
Потом групповой обработкой "записываете" документы.
14 AlexBor
 
naïve
03.10.14
16:09
(13) Спасибо это подходящий вариант я об этом не подумал
15 silent person
 
03.10.14
16:09
реквизит с именем 'n' - информативно однако.
16 StaticUnsafe
 
03.10.14
16:09
(11) переучились в "программисты" из менеджеров?
17 AlexBor
 
naïve
03.10.14
16:10
(12) не буду
18 AlexBor
 
naïve
03.10.14
16:11
(16) из топ менеджеров --  кризис знаете ли
19 AlexBor
 
naïve
03.10.14
16:13
(16) а у вас как с этим из каких в программисты нырнули?
20 Zamestas
 
03.10.14
16:15
(0) А зачем итого хранить в реквизите?
21 MaxS
 
03.10.14
16:16
(0) Неправильный запрос? Зачем в запросе пересчитывать результат запроса?

Судя по коду, теперь нет удивления почему за события в одной стране, вводят санкции на другую.
Не тот объект для санкций выбрали. И результат от санкций в третьих странах ощущается.
22 AlexBor
 
naïve
03.10.14
16:19
(21) работает все нормально
23 Михаил Козлов
 
03.10.14
16:24
(20) Через реквизит искать удобно. Например, ППВ на определенную сумму.
Основная теорема систематики: Новые системы плодят новые проблемы.